Quonset

Round rolled roof design optimized for 16-230 occupant capacity. Ideal for mid-size Knoxville facilities requiring underground protection without surface footprint impact across Knox County.

 

Technical Specifications:

  • Custom sizing for specific Knoxville facility requirements
  • FEMA P-361 & ICC-500 compliant design
  • Coal tar epoxy coating with cathodic protection
  • 45-degree ergonomic staircase with double entry
  • Optional concrete barrier surrounding shelter
  • Modular bench seating configurations

Capacity Range: 16-230 people Design: Quarter-inch steel with round rolled roof Installation: Complete below-grade concealment

Modular

Rectangular modular design for Knoxville facilities requiring 80-1,500+ occupant capacity. No project capacity limit—modular engineering scales to any Knox County business requirement.

 

Technical Specifications:

  • Unlimited capacity through modular expansion
  • Structural channel & tubular exoskeleton (24″ on center)
  • Coal tar epoxy coating with cathodic protection
  • Multiple entry/exit configurations available
  • Custom module arrangements for site-specific Knoxville requirements
  • FEMA P-361 & ICC-500 compliant engineering

Capacity Range: 80-1,500+ people Design: Quarter-inch steel rectangular modules Installation: Multi-module underground configuration

EstateMax

20′ x 6′ underground shelter ideal for small Knoxville businesses and professional offices. Quick installation with minimal site disruption across Knox County.

 

Technical Specifications:

  • Compact footprint for small Knoxville business operations
  • Double-welded watertight construction
  • Triple-locking keyed mechanism
  • Plumbing and electrical hookups
  • Structural extended floor
  • Three-side bench seating

Capacity Range: 20-30 people Design: Quarter-inch steel rectangular design Installation: Rapid underground installation

Can underground shelters be installed in Knoxville’s rocky terrain?

Site conditions vary throughout Knox County. Professional site evaluation determines feasibility for each Knoxville property. Properties with adequate soil depth work well for underground installation. Properties with shallow bedrock may work better for above-ground installation. Our engineers assess bedrock depth and recommend appropriate solutions.

How long does underground commercial installation take in Knoxville?

Knox County permit approval takes 4-6 weeks. Underground excavation and installation require 2-4 weeks depending on capacity and terrain. Total timeline: 6-8 weeks from order to operational for most Knoxville commercial underground projects. Rocky terrain may extend timeline slightly.
